The hazard identification signal is a color coded array of four numbers or letters arranged in a diamond shape. The colors are: blue, red, yellow and white. A value of zero means that the material poses essentially no hazard; a ratig of four indicates extreme danger.

The hazchem symbol is a diamond-shaped sign that is used to indicate the presence of dangerous goods. It features a unique code and color that helps emergency responders identify the type of hazard present in a transportation or storage situation.
